The movie ‘Hari Hara Veera Mallu,’ featuring Pawan Kalyan, has experienced a slowdown in its box office earnings. After a promising opening, the film’s collections on day 3 amounted to approximately Rs 7.44 crore. The total earnings so far are around Rs 62 crore. This follows a strong first-day performance, where the film collected Rs 34.75 crore. Production was affected by delays, with Pawan Kalyan citing the pandemic and his political career as contributors to the postponement. The narrative of ‘Hari Hara Veera Mallu’ is set in the Mughal period, and revolves around the character Veera Mallu and his mission to steal the Kohinoor diamond. Krish Jagarlamudi and AM Jyothi Krishna directed the film, which stars Bobby Deol, Nidhhi Agerwal, Nargis Fakhri, Nora Fatehi, and Satyaraj. The music for the film is composed by M. M. Keeravani.
